ta: pkcs11: add hidden EC point support

The PKCS#11 standard does not allow one to have CKA_EC_POINT for private
keys but TEE internal API requires one to be present when performing
private key operations. Instead of calculating it each time it is needed
store it as hidden attribute.

This fixes EC private key generation to function as specified in standard.

There is backwards support for existing keys that has been created
inadvertently with CKA_EC_POINT included.

ta: pkcs11: Fix key generation for Ed25519

The ECC curve is not an attribute of an Ed25519 key pair.
Remove it from the key generation attribute.

Add getting key size by using EC_POINT attribute.

ta: pkcs11: support for ECDH1_DERIVE

Add support for ECDH1_DERIVE operation.

Only the key derivation function CKD_NULL is supported: the raw shared
secret value is therefore generated without applying any key
derivation function.

Tested with pkcs11_tool -m ECDH1-DERIVE

ta: pkcs11: Add support for elliptic curve signing & verification

Add support for performing elliptic curve signing & verification
operations for:

- ECDSA with supplied hash value
- Multi stage SHA-1
- Multi stage SHA-224
- Multi stage SHA-256
- Multi stage SHA-384
- Multi stage SHA-512

Specified in:
PKCS #11 Cryptographic Token Interface Current Mechanisms Specification
Version 2.40 Plus Errata 01
2.3 Elliptic Curve
